AMARONAUTA
Born in southern Piedmont, a land historically characterized by the passage of merchants traveling between the Port of Genoa and the cities of Northern Italy. These travelers contributed to the import and local spread of rare products such as citrus fruits and exotics, including cocoa, ginger, and rhubarb. Liquori Bureau selects these botanicals and, enriching them with local roots such as alpine gentian, reinterprets them into a contemporary amaro designed for modern-day adventurers.
